如何实现办公视频会议软件的语音识别功能?

随着互联网技术的飞速发展,办公视频会议软件已经成为企业日常沟通的重要工具。然而,如何实现办公视频会议软件的语音识别功能,成为了许多企业关注的焦点。本文将深入探讨如何实现这一功能,帮助您提升办公效率。

一、语音识别技术概述

语音识别技术是指让计算机通过识别和理解人类的语音,把语音信号转变为相应的文本或命令的技术。在办公视频会议软件中,语音识别功能可以帮助用户实时将语音转换为文字,方便记录和查阅。

二、实现语音识别功能的步骤

  1. 采集语音信号:首先,需要通过麦克风采集与会人员的语音信号。为了保证语音质量,建议使用高质量的麦克风。

  2. 语音预处理:对采集到的语音信号进行预处理,包括降噪、静音检测、语音增强等,以提高语音识别的准确率。

  3. 特征提取:将预处理后的语音信号转换为计算机可以处理的特征向量。常用的特征提取方法有梅尔频率倒谱系数(MFCC)、线性预测编码(LPC)等。

  4. 模型训练:使用大量标注好的语音数据对语音识别模型进行训练。常见的模型有隐马尔可夫模型(HMM)、深度神经网络(DNN)等。

  5. 语音识别:将特征向量输入训练好的模型,得到识别结果。识别结果可以是文字、命令或意图。

  6. 后处理:对识别结果进行后处理,包括语法纠错、同音字替换等,以提高识别结果的准确性。

三、案例分析

以某知名办公视频会议软件为例,该软件采用了深度神经网络(DNN)作为语音识别模型。通过不断优化模型和算法,该软件的语音识别准确率达到了98%以上,满足了企业日常沟通的需求。

四、总结

实现办公视频会议软件的语音识别功能,需要从语音采集、预处理、特征提取、模型训练、语音识别和后处理等多个环节进行优化。通过采用先进的语音识别技术,可以大大提高办公效率,降低沟通成本。

猜你喜欢:海外直播网络搭建方案